Software Update Frequency

The frequency of software updates can impact the user experience, security, and feature availability. Fitbit and Garmin have different approaches to updating their devices.

Fitbit Charge 6

Fitbit typically releases software updates for the Charge series every 1 to 3 months. These updates often include bug fixes, security patches, and new features. Fitbit’s app ecosystem is tightly integrated with its devices, allowing for regular improvements via the companion app.

Garmin Vivosmart 5

Garmin generally provides software updates for the Vivosmart series approximately every 2 to 4 months. Garmin emphasizes stability and reliability, with updates focusing on performance enhancements, new watch faces, and activity tracking improvements.

Features Comparison

Design and Display

The Fitbit Charge 6 features a sleek, modern design with a bright AMOLED display, making it easy to view notifications and health stats at a glance. The Garmin Vivosmart 5 has a slim profile with a transflective display optimized for outdoor visibility and long battery life.

Health and Fitness Tracking

  • Fitbit Charge 6: Heart rate monitoring, SpO2 tracking, sleep analysis, Active Zone Minutes, and built-in GPS.
  • Garmin Vivosmart 5: Heart rate monitoring, Body Battery energy monitoring, stress tracking, and a pulse oximeter.

Smart Features

  • Fitbit Charge 6: Notifications for calls, texts, calendar, music controls, and Fitbit Pay.
  • Garmin Vivosmart 5: Smart notifications, music controls, and incident detection.

Battery Life

The Garmin Vivosmart 5 generally offers longer battery life, lasting up to 7 days on a single charge. The Fitbit Charge 6 typically lasts around 5 days, depending on usage and display settings.
